Wilsonton demographics (2021 Census)

The figures below profile Wilsonton using the Australian Bureau of Statistics 2021 Census; every percentage is a share of a clearly stated Census count, so each one traces back to the source. At a glance, the largest age group is seniors (65+) at 25% and 12% of residents were born overseas.

Weather and climate in Wilsonton

Based on 2014–2023 records, the warmest month in Wilsonton is January (average daytime high around 29°C) and the coolest is July (around 17.7°C). The area receives roughly 777 mm of rain across the year.

Is Wilsonton an advantaged area?

Wilsonton has an ABS SEIFA score of 872, where about 1000 is the national average — higher scores indicate greater relative socio-economic advantage. That gives it a Suburb Score of 7 out of 100 — more socio-economically advantaged than about 7% of Australian suburbs.
